Water Dishes and Hydration Accessories

The water dish is arguably the most important accessory in any Pueblan Milk Snake enclosure, serving triple duty as a hydration source, a humidity contributor, and an occasional soaking basin. Selecting the right dish involves balancing several practical considerations: size, weight, material, and placement within the enclosure. The dish must be large enough for the snake to submerge at least half its body for soaking during pre-shed periods, shallow enough that the snake can enter and exit without difficulty, and heavy enough that the snake cannot tip it during its nocturnal movements.

Ceramic water dishes are the gold standard for most colubrid enclosures. Their weight provides natural tip resistance — a significant advantage with Pueblan Milk Snakes, which frequently push against and climb over objects during exploration. Glazed ceramic is nonporous, which means it does not absorb bacteria or retain odors the way unfinished clay or wood would. Cleaning is straightforward: a weekly scrub with a reptile-safe disinfectant and thorough rinsing restores the dish to hygienic condition. The primary disadvantage of ceramic is its fragility — a dropped dish will crack or shatter — but in normal enclosure use, a quality ceramic dish lasts for years.

Molded resin dishes designed specifically for reptile enclosures offer the aesthetic advantage of naturalistic rock or wood textures while providing the practical benefits of a lightweight, virtually unbreakable container. Many resin dishes incorporate low-profile entry ramps that make them accessible even to small snakes. The textured surfaces of these dishes can be slightly more difficult to clean than smooth ceramic because waste and biofilm can accumulate in the surface irregularities, but a stiff brush and disinfectant solution address this effectively.

Water quality matters more than most keepers realize. Municipal tap water treated with chlorine or chloramine can irritate the mucous membranes of the snake's mouth and esophagus during drinking. Using a water conditioner designed for reptile use, or simply allowing tap water to sit in an open container for twenty-four hours to allow chlorine to off-gas before adding it to the dish, eliminates this concern. Well water should be tested periodically for heavy metals and mineral content, as excessively hard water or water with elevated iron or sulfur levels can contribute to scale discoloration and digestive irritation over time.

Placement of the water dish within the enclosure influences both the snake's use of it and its contribution to ambient humidity. Positioning the dish in the transition zone between the warm and cool ends of the enclosure provides moderate evaporation — enough to contribute meaningfully to humidity without overwhelming the enclosure's moisture balance. A dish placed directly on the warm end evaporates too quickly, requiring frequent refilling and risking excessive humidity, while a dish on the cool end evaporates slowly and may not contribute enough moisture in dry environments.

Handling Tools and Equipment

While Pueblan Milk Snakes are among the more docile colubrid species and are generally comfortable with direct hand contact after an acclimation period, certain handling tools improve safety and reduce stress during specific interactions. These tools are not substitutes for hands-on handling but serve as supplements for situations where direct contact is either impractical or inadvisable.

Snake hooks in the small-to-medium size range are invaluable for initial contact with a Pueblan Milk Snake that is concealed in its hide or buried in substrate. Gently sliding a hook beneath the snake's midbody and lifting it partially out of its hiding spot gives the snake a tactile cue that handling is about to occur, reducing the startle response that a hand reaching directly into a dark hide can trigger. Once the snake is alert and oriented, the keeper can transfer it to hand support. A hook with a rounded, smooth tip and a shaft length of twelve to eighteen inches provides adequate reach without excessive leverage.

Feeding tongs, distinct from handling hooks, serve a specific purpose during meal presentation. Ten-to-twelve-inch stainless-steel hemostats with a locking mechanism allow the keeper to grip the prey item securely, present it with controlled movement, and release it cleanly once the snake strikes. Rubber-tipped or silicone-coated tongs provide a softer contact point if the snake accidentally strikes the tong rather than the prey, reducing the risk of dental damage. Tongs should never be used to handle the snake itself — their gripping force is designed for prey presentation, not for the delicate contact required when supporting a living animal.

Heavy-duty gloves are sometimes recommended for handling defensive milk snakes, but their use with Pueblan Milk Snakes specifically is generally unnecessary and can be counterproductive. Thick gloves eliminate the keeper's ability to feel the snake's muscle tension, grip strength, and movement cues, which are important indicators of the animal's stress level during handling. A Pueblan Milk Snake that bites — and defensive bites from new or frightened individuals do occur — inflicts a superficial wound that is easily cleaned and treated. The snake benefits far more from the tactile sensitivity of bare-hand handling than from the impersonal bulk of gloved contact.

A secure, ventilated container should be available for temporary housing during enclosure cleaning and maintenance. A plastic tub with a secure, ventilated lid in the six-to-fifteen-quart range serves this purpose well. The container should be opaque or lined with a dark cloth to reduce visual stimulation during the transfer, and it should contain a small piece of paper towel or substrate for the snake's comfort. This temporary container should be inspected before every use to confirm that the lid seals completely and that no cracks or warping have developed since its last use.

Shedding Aids and Skin Care

Shedding is a recurring physiological event that occurs every four to eight weeks in healthy Pueblan Milk Snakes, with younger, faster-growing individuals shedding more frequently than adults in maintenance mode. A complete, clean shed — in which the skin comes off in a single piece from nose to tail tip — is a reliable indicator of good health and proper husbandry. Incomplete sheds, also called retained sheds, signal that humidity is too low, the snake is dehydrated, or there is an underlying health issue that requires attention. Several accessories support the shedding process and help keepers manage this aspect of care.

The humid hide is the most important shedding accessory, providing a localized zone of elevated humidity where the snake can position itself during the pre-shed and active shedding phases. Commercially available humid hides come in various sizes and designs, from simple plastic containers with entrance holes to molded resin caves with naturalistic textures. The interior is lined with dampened sphagnum moss, which retains moisture effectively and creates a humid microenvironment of seventy to eighty percent relative humidity within the hide. The moss should be re-dampened every two to three days and replaced weekly, or more frequently if it begins to develop an off-odor or visible mold.

Shedding-aid sprays and misting products formulated for reptiles can supplement the humid hide during particularly stubborn shed cycles. These products typically contain aloe or similar emollients that soften retained skin when applied directly to the affected area. They are most useful after an incomplete shed has already occurred, as a treatment rather than a preventive measure. Spraying the snake lightly and allowing it to return to its humid hide often loosens retained spectacles, tail tips, and body patches that did not release during the primary shed event.

A shallow soaking container filled with lukewarm water — roughly eighty to eighty-five degrees Fahrenheit — provides a more intensive intervention for retained shed. Placing the snake in one to two inches of water in a secure, covered container for fifteen to twenty minutes softens adhered skin and allows the snake's natural movements to work it free. The water level should never exceed the height of the snake's body to prevent the risk of aspiration, and the snake should never be left unattended during a soak. Most retained shed resolves within one or two soaking sessions when combined with a properly maintained humid hide.

Rough-textured objects within the enclosure assist the snake in initiating the shedding process. When a Pueblan Milk Snake is ready to shed, it rubs its nose against a rough surface to create a tear in the old skin at the lip line, then crawls forward out of the skin like pulling off a sock. Rough-surfaced rocks, textured resin decorations, and unfinished cork bark all provide the abrasive contact the snake needs to start this process. An enclosure furnished entirely with smooth surfaces can make initiating a shed more difficult and may contribute to incomplete shedding even when humidity is adequate.

Travel and Transport Containers

Every Pueblan Milk Snake keeper needs reliable transport equipment for veterinary visits, relocations, temporary housing during enclosure maintenance, and the initial journey home after acquisition. The requirements for safe snake transport are straightforward but non-negotiable: secure containment, adequate ventilation, thermal stability, and minimal visual and vibrational stress.

Cloth snake bags made from breathable, tightly woven cotton or muslin are the traditional transport method used by breeders and experienced keepers. The snake is placed inside the bag, which is then knotted or tied securely at the top, and the bagged snake is placed inside a secondary container — a rigid plastic tub or insulated box — for physical protection during transit. Cloth bags work because the close contact with fabric has a calming effect on many snake species, and the breathable material prevents overheating. The bag must be free of holes, loose threads, and frayed seams that the snake could push through or become entangled in.

Rigid plastic containers with secure lids and ventilation holes offer a more structured alternative to cloth bags and are particularly practical for short transport durations such as the drive to a veterinarian's office. A six-to-ten-quart container with a firmly latching lid and half a dozen quarter-inch ventilation holes drilled in the upper walls provides secure, ventilated containment. Lining the bottom with damp paper towels prevents the snake from sliding on the smooth plastic during vehicle movements and maintains adequate humidity during transit.

Temperature management during transport is critical and often overlooked. A Pueblan Milk Snake transported in a container that sits in a sun-baked car can overheat within minutes, and temperatures above ninety-five degrees Fahrenheit can be fatal in a confined, poorly ventilated space. Conversely, winter transport requires insulation to prevent the snake from chilling below safe temperatures. Insulated shipping boxes, heat packs rated at seventy-two or forty-hour durations, and cold packs for summer transport are all essential components of a complete transport kit. Heat packs should never contact the snake directly — wrapping them in paper towels or placing them in a separate compartment of the transport box prevents thermal burns.

Transport duration should be minimized whenever possible. Pueblan Milk Snakes tolerate short transport of an hour or less without significant stress provided the container is secure, adequately ventilated, and maintained within the seventy-to-eighty-five-degree temperature range. Longer journeys — such as those involved in purchasing a snake from a distant breeder or relocating across state lines — require more careful planning, including rest stops to check the container temperature, fresh water availability for journeys exceeding six hours, and coordination with the destination to ensure the enclosure is fully set up and acclimated before the snake arrives.

Cleaning and Sanitation Supplies

Maintaining a hygienic enclosure requires a dedicated set of cleaning supplies that are reserved exclusively for reptile use and never cross-contaminated with household cleaning products. The investment in proper sanitation equipment is modest but pays dividends in disease prevention over the snake's lifetime. A well-stocked cleaning kit eliminates the temptation to improvise with whatever products happen to be under the kitchen sink, some of which may contain compounds that are toxic to reptiles.

Reptile-safe disinfectants form the core of the cleaning kit. Chlorhexidine solution, available through veterinary suppliers and many reptile retailers, is the preferred broad-spectrum disinfectant for snake enclosures. It is effective against bacteria, fungi, and many viruses at the dilutions recommended for reptile use, and it has a well-established safety profile when rinsed appropriately. F10 veterinary disinfectant is another excellent option with documented efficacy against a wide range of pathogens including the notoriously resistant Cryptosporidium. Both products should be diluted according to manufacturer instructions — stronger is not better, as unnecessarily concentrated solutions leave more residue and increase the rinse burden.

Dedicated scrubbing tools — a stiff-bristled brush for enclosure surfaces, a smaller brush for water dishes and hides, and a set of microfiber cloths for wiping down glass — should be labeled and stored separately from household cleaning supplies. Color-coding these tools prevents accidental cross-use. The brushes should be rinsed in clean water after each use and allowed to air-dry completely before storage to prevent them from becoming bacterial reservoirs themselves.

Disposable supplies including nitrile gloves, paper towels, and waste bags streamline the cleaning process and minimize direct contact with biological waste. Nitrile gloves are preferred over latex for keepers with latex sensitivities, and they provide a reliable barrier during substrate changes and waste removal. A roll of paper towels dedicated to reptile use avoids the possibility of transferring cleaning product residues from general-purpose towels that may have been used with household cleaners.

A spray bottle filled with the appropriate disinfectant dilution, clearly labeled and stored with the reptile cleaning kit, allows for quick spot treatment between full cleaning sessions. When a waste deposit is removed during daily spot cleaning, a light spray of disinfectant on the vacated area followed by a wipe with a clean paper towel provides interim sanitation. This targeted approach addresses contamination at the point of occurrence and extends the interval between full substrate changes without compromising hygiene.

Identification and Record-Keeping Supplies

For keepers who maintain more than one Pueblan Milk Snake or who breed this subspecies, reliable identification and thorough record-keeping are essential management practices. Even single-snake keepers benefit from maintaining organized health and husbandry records that document the animal's history from acquisition through its entire lifespan. The accessories and tools that support identification and record-keeping are inexpensive but serve an organizational function that becomes invaluable over time.

Enclosure labeling is the simplest and most immediately useful identification practice. A label affixed to the exterior of the enclosure that includes the snake's name or identifier, its sex, date of birth or estimated age, date of acquisition, and any relevant notes — such as specific feeding preferences or medical history — provides at-a-glance information that prevents confusion and supports consistent care, particularly when another person is caring for the snake temporarily. Laminated index cards, printed adhesive labels, or dry-erase labels attached to the enclosure glass or frame all work effectively.

Digital record-keeping applications designed for reptile keepers have become increasingly sophisticated and offer structured tracking for feeding schedules, shedding dates, weight measurements, veterinary visits, and breeding events. These applications generate longitudinal data visualizations that reveal trends invisible in day-to-day observation — gradual weight gain over six months, a consistent seasonal feeding refusal pattern, or a slowly lengthening shed interval that may indicate the early stages of a health issue. Several well-reviewed reptile management apps are available for both mobile and desktop platforms, and many allow data export for veterinary consultation.

A gram-accurate digital kitchen scale is an accessory that bridges identification, record-keeping, and health monitoring. Weighing the snake at consistent intervals — monthly for adults, biweekly for growing juveniles — produces a weight curve that is one of the most objective health indicators available to the keeper. A Pueblan Milk Snake that is gaining weight steadily during its growth phase and maintaining a stable weight as an adult is demonstrating appropriate nutritional intake and metabolic function. An unexplained weight loss trend is an early warning signal that prompts closer examination of husbandry parameters and potentially a veterinary consultation.

Photographic documentation is an underutilized record-keeping tool that is virtually free with modern smartphones. Photographing the snake at regular intervals — monthly or at each shed — creates a visual timeline of growth, scale condition, coloration changes, and overall body condition that supplements weight data. Photographs are also invaluable for documenting injuries, skin abnormalities, or suspected health issues when communicating with a veterinarian remotely. Consistent lighting and positioning in each photograph improves the usefulness of comparisons over time.

Emergency and First Aid Supplies

A small, well-organized first aid kit dedicated to the Pueblan Milk Snake enables the keeper to respond promptly to minor injuries and stabilize the animal in the event of a more serious health issue while veterinary care is arranged. The kit does not replace professional veterinary treatment but provides the tools needed for immediate response and basic wound management.

Betadine solution, diluted to the color of weak tea, is the primary wound-cleaning agent for superficial abrasions, minor cuts, and small burns. These injuries can occur from rough enclosure furnishings, retained shed constricting a tail tip, or accidental contact with an improperly regulated heat source. Applying diluted betadine with a cotton swab or soft gauze pad cleans the wound without causing tissue damage, and it can be repeated daily until the wound shows clear signs of healing. Hydrogen peroxide should not be used on snake wounds — it damages healthy tissue and delays healing.

Silver sulfadiazine cream, available by prescription from a reptile veterinarian, is the standard topical treatment for thermal burns in reptiles. Keeping a small tube in the first aid kit ensures that burn treatment can begin immediately if a thermostat failure or heating element malfunction results in a contact burn. The cream is applied in a thin layer over the affected area after cleaning with dilute betadine. Burns on snakes are serious injuries that always warrant veterinary evaluation even if the initial damage appears minor, because the full extent of tissue damage from thermal burns may not become apparent for several days.

Hemostatic powder or cornstarch serves as an emergency blood-stopping agent for minor bleeding from a torn scale or a superficial cut. A small pinch applied to the bleeding site with gentle pressure typically stops minor hemorrhage within minutes. Significant or persistent bleeding, active arterial bleeding, or bleeding associated with trauma to the head or cloaca requires immediate veterinary attention and should not be managed with first aid measures alone.

A pair of fine-tipped tweezers and a magnifying glass support the removal of retained shed fragments, particularly around the eyes and tail tip, and allow close inspection of scale surfaces for mites, ticks, or early signs of skin infection. Retained eye caps — the spectacles — are a common consequence of low-humidity shedding and must be removed carefully to prevent damage to the underlying eye. If the retained spectacle does not release after a gentle soak and light application of shedding aid, veterinary removal is the safest course of action, as aggressive attempts to peel the spectacle can lacerate the cornea.

The first aid kit should be stored in a clearly labeled, sealed container near the snake's enclosure and inspected every three months to replace expired products, replenish consumable supplies, and verify that all items are in usable condition. Keeping a card in the kit with the contact information for the nearest reptile-experienced veterinarian and the number for an emergency exotic animal clinic ensures that help can be reached without delay when it is needed most.
